Watering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ris

Water is the most essential need of any plant. Watering requirements differ for every plant. Knowing the amount of water required is the most important part of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ris Facts. One needs to adequately water the plants keeping in mind that plants need season wise variations in water levels. While taking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ris care, it is important to know that too much water is more dangerous than not enough watering. Here we provide you with the exact watering required for your garden plant. Watering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ris is as follows:

  • Watering Chinese Dogwood in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Chinese Dogwood in Winter: Average Water

  • Watering Dutch Iris in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Dutch Iris in Winter: Average Water

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ris Diseases

Plants get infected many times due to lack of care. This makes it unhealthy and reduces its life too. Hence it is necessary to know the kind of disease on plants, to cure it and keep the plant healthy. Knowing About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ris diseases is very important factor of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ris Care. These plant's diseases are:

  • Chinese Dogwood: Crown Canker, Leaf spot and Scorch
  • Dutch Iris: Bacteria, fungus and Viruses

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ris Pruning

Pruning is an important part of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ris pruning is done as follows:

  • Chinese Dogwood p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ves

  • Dutch Iris p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ves

Plants need fertilizers for its growth and increasing the life. Chinese Dogwood and Dutch Iris fertilizers are as follows:

  • Chinese Dogwood fertilizers: Ratio of 12-4-8 or 16-4-8
  • Dutch Iris fertilizers: All-Purpose Liquid Fertilizer
